About this experience

If you have always dreamt of learning to dive, discover new sensations or just want to explore the diversity of the ocean, the Discover Scuba Diving course is your starting point towards underwater adventure.
This diving initiation is made for you !

Please be reassured, the learning curve is progressive. After a short briefing, an instructor will take you to the swimming pool to help you to be at ease with your equipment and this new extraordinary sensation that is breathing underwater. They will also give all the notions of buoyancy so that you make the best of your dive in the sea. Next you will embark on our boat, next stop Mantas !
Maximum depth 12 meters (40 feet).

About Nusa Lembongan

Nusa Lembongan is a small island located southeast of Bali, known for its stunning beaches, crystal-clear waters, and laid-back atmosphere. It offers a perfect escape from the bustling tourist spots of Bali, with a focus on eco-tourism and natural beauty.

Must-Try Local Dishes

Nasi Goreng

Fried rice with vegetables, meat, and spices, often served with a fried egg.

Lunch/Dinner Vegetarian options available

Gado-Gado

A salad of slightly boiled, blanched, or steamed vegetables and hard-boiled eggs, fried tofu, and tempeh, served with peanut sauce dressing.

Lunch/Dinner Vegetarian

Pisang Goreng

Fried banana with sweet and crispy texture.

Dessert Vegetarian
